If anyone remembers my thread from last week I was going to look at a boat. Owner flaked and I moved on from it. My buddy who found it hounded the owner and we went to go look at it.
Got to the home it was being stored at. Had a cover and was pretty well taken care of. We removed the cover and I checked the interior. It looks like the cover was off in the fall, a bunch of leaves and such in the seats. The battery was dead, so we hooked up a jump pack, turned the key and the "Stabil" filled fuel fired the engine up. We shut it down and I was pretty happy that it ran.
Checking over the boat, the floors were solid and all the electrics worked. The paperwork was good, so no worries there. Checking out the transom, it was solid on the inside and on the outside it has been strengthened with a diamond steel plate. I was a little suspicious of this, but I called a boat mechanic friend and sent him some pictures. He said he had done it before and it's used when you've got a larger engine and want to be safe rather than sorry. P.O. ran it like that for 2 years, so I wasn't too worried.
After some discussion and checking out the trailer, I made the deal. Hooked up the trailer and checked the wiring. The connector was pretty brittle, but the lights worked. Owner gave me a hitch and brought her home!
So here she sits, at home waiting for me to clean her out. I cut the trailer wiring off so I can replace it, but for now it's in good shape and I can't wait to work on it!
